Twitter

Love it or hate it, Twitter provides an outlet for the public to discuss topics trending in breaking news, sports, culture and more. Brands continue to have success on the platform for product launches and live events. And it should be interesting to follow the direction of the company in the coming year, particularly after the announcement of a new CEO. Twitter Marketing recently released its “Best of Tweets” 2021 edition, honoring the top creative and engaging uses of the platform. Here are the selections most popular with users this year. (These picks were based on algorithms tailored to each category, the company says. Brands were ranked by total mentions, likes, Retweets, Quote Tweets, replies and views). 

Most popular brand Tweet:

@nickjr 

Most Tweeted about brand:

@disneyplus

Most Tweeted brand hashtag:

@NintendoAmerica, #NintendoSwitch

Twitter also provided a list of the most popular brand handles per vertical. Some included @FortniteGame for tech, @McDonalds for dining, @Delta for travel and @Toyota for auto. 

TikTok

TikTok continues to grow. In 2021, more than one billion people turned to Tiktok “to be entertained, find and share joy with others, and learn new things,” the company said.

And while TikTok may be most popular when utilized for entertainment or product awareness, it’s only a matter of time before brands figure out targeted ways to stimulate commerce.  TikTok says, “Home, beauty, and gadgets were among the categories that sparked shopping trends and 'community commerce' conversations this year.”

Check out products in the United States that benefitted most from the platform in 2021.

YouTube

YouTube remains one of the top social media platforms measured by users' time on site. A report from app analytics firm App Annie says as of June 2021, users watched 22 hours and 40 minutes of YouTube content per month. There’s something for everyone and it blends a great variety of brands and personal creators. Check out the most viewed videos uploaded in 2021, and what resonates with users. 

  1. MrBeast: I Spent 50 Hours Buried Alive

2. Dream: Minecraft Speedrunner VS 5 Hunters

3. Mark Rober: Glitterbomb Trap Catches Phone Scammer (who gets arrested)

4. NFL: The Weeknd's FULL Pepsi Super Bowl LV Halftime Show

5. CoryxKenshin: Friday Night Funkin' KEEPS GETTING BETTER AND BETTER (Part 2)
